111 years ago in January 1909 a payroll robbery in Tottenham led to a frantic pursuit of Latvian anarchists over the Lea River marshes. Four people died including PC. William Tyler, who lies buried in Abney Park under one of it’s finest monuments.

Led by Alan Gartrell, this tour will tell the story of the ‘Tottenham Outrage’. The stories of P.C Alfred Smith and others killed in the line of duty will also be revealed.
